site stats

Dfa induction

WebThe following DFA recognizes the language containing either the substring $101$ or $010$. I need to prove this by using induction. So far, I have managed to split each state up … WebSep 21, 2024 · 2. You can prove your DFA is minimal by proving that every state is both reachable and distinguishable. To prove a state st is reachable, you must give a word (a possibly empty sequence of symbols) that goes from the starting state ( q0 in your diagram) to state st. So for your diagram, you must give six words: one for each of q0, q1, q2, q3 ...

Finite Automata - Washington State University

WebProb: Given a State Table of DFA, decribe what language is accepted, and prove by induction it accepts that language, use induction on length of string. As it accepts language, stings with at least one 00 in them. Basis: let w be the string, s.t w = 00 dlt-hat (A,w) = C as C is accepting state. Webδ(q, a) = the state that the DFA goes to when it is in state q and input a is received. 8 Graph Representation of DFA’s Nodes = states. Arcs represent transition function. ... Induction on length of string. Basis: δ(q, ε) = q Induction: δ(q,wa) = δ(δ(q,w),a) w is a string; a is an input symbol. 12 Extended δ: Intuition nova scotia moose hunting outfitters https://simul-fortes.com

Equivalence of DFA and NFA - University of …

WebDeterministic Finite Automata - Definition A Deterministic Finite Automaton (DFA) consists of: Q ==> a finite set of states ∑ ==> a finite set of input symbols (alphabet) q0==>a> a startstatestart state F ==> set of final states δ==> a transition function, which is a mapping bt Qbetween Q x ∑ ==> QQ A DFA is defined by the 5-tuple: WebDeterministic Finite State Automata (DFA or DFSA) DFA/DFSA: A DFA is a quintuple (Q; ;q 0;F; ) where Qis a xed, nite, non-empty set of states. is a xed ( nite, non-empty) alphabet (Q\ = fg). q ... Hence, by induction, state invariant holds for all strings s2 . NOTE: The proof has one case for each possible state and one sub-case for each ... WebA DFA is defined as an abstract mathematical concept, but is often implemented in hardware and software for solving various specific problems such as lexical analysis and … how to sketch poses

CSC236 Week 10 - Department of Computer Science, …

Category:Deterministic finite automaton - Wikipedia

Tags:Dfa induction

Dfa induction

Differential Fault Attacks on RSA Smartcards - UC Santa …

Websome DFA if and only if Lis accepted by some NFA. Proof: The \ if" part is Theorem 2.11. For the \ only. if" part we note that any DFA can be converted to an equivalent NFA by … WebMay 6, 2024 · Step-01: Form an equation for each state considering the transitions which come towards that state. Add ‘∈’ in the equation of the initial state. Step-02: Bring the final state in the form R = Q + RP to get the required regular expression. If P does not contain a null string ∈, then-.

Dfa induction

Did you know?

http://koclab.cs.ucsb.edu/teaching/cren/project/2005past/vo.pdf

WebProof: Let A and B be DFA’s whose languages are L and M, respectively. Construct C, the product automaton of A and B. Make the final states of C be the pairs consisting of final states of both A and B. 6 Example: Product DFA for ... Induction: Let w = xa; assume IH for x. WebDefinition: A deterministic finite automaton (DFA) consists of 1. a finite set of states (often denoted Q) 2. a finite set Σ of symbols (alphabet) 3. a transition function that …

WebOct 6, 2014 · Automata proof by Induction. Thread starter null3; Start date Oct 6, 2014; Tags automata dfa induction proof N. null3. Sep 2014 2 0 Canada Oct 6, 2014 #1 Let: ... Generally we have a DFA (Deterministic Finite Automata) which determines whether the given input is valid or not: WebInduction is a proof principle that is often used to establish a statement of the form \for all natural numbers i, some property P(i) holds", i.e., 8i2N:P(i). In this class, there will be …

WebMar 18, 2014 · Mathematical induction is a method of mathematical proof typically used to establish a given statement for all natural numbers. It is done in two steps. The first step, known as the base …

http://infolab.stanford.edu/~ullman/ialc/spr10/slides/fa2.pdf nova scotia movie theatersWeb2 Inductive de nitions and structural induction It is often useful to de ne a set using a set of rules for adding things to the set. For example, we can de ne the set using the following … nova scotia ministry of healthWebsome DFA if and only if Lis accepted by some NFA. Proof: The \ if" part is Theorem 2.11. For the \ only. if" part we note that any DFA can be converted to an equivalent NFA by mod-ifying the D. to N. by the rule If D (q;a) = p, then N (q;a) = fpg. By induction on jwjit will be shown in the tutorial that if ^ D (q. 0;w) = p, then ^ N (q. 0;w) = fpg. how to sketch quadratic equationsWebApr 24, 2024 · This video proves the correctness of the very simple on-off switch from the previous video using weak mutual induction. nova scotia museum health careWebFormal Definition of a DFA. A DFA can be represented by a 5-tuple (Q, ∑, δ, q 0, F) where −. Q is a finite set of states. ∑ is a finite set of symbols called the alphabet. δ is the transition function where δ: Q × ∑ → Q. q0 is the initial state from where any input is processed (q 0 ∈ Q). F is a set of final state/states of Q (F ... how to sketch rational functionsWebPick the most restrictive type: the DFA. 9 Converting a RE to an ε-NFA Proof is an induction on the number of operators (+, concatenation, *) in the ... DFA-to-RE A strange sort of induction. States of the DFA are assumed to be … nova scotia msi change of addressWebIn the theory of computation, a branch of theoretical computer science, a deterministic finite automaton (DFA)—also known as deterministic finite acceptor (DFA), deterministic finite-state machine (DFSM), or deterministic finite-state automaton (DFSA)—is a finite-state machine that accepts or rejects a given string of symbols, by running through a state … nova scotia msi health card renewal form